Arthur en vrai ! is a curious exploration of identity and the absurdity of fame, wrapped in a whimsical yet introspective tone. The pacing feels almost meandering at times, which adds to its charm, allowing you to linger on the quirky characters and their interactions. There's a rawness to the practical effects that gives it a grounded feel; it doesn’t shy away from the awkwardness of real life. The performances are sincere, almost childlike, drawing you into their world while asking deeper questions about authenticity. It's this blend of absurdity and sincerity that makes it distinctly memorable, leaving you pondering long after the credits roll.
Arthur en vrai ! has seen limited distribution, making it somewhat of a rarity among collectors. It often appears in obscure independent film collections, yet it hasn’t gained widespread recognition, which adds to its allure. The film's unique tone and practical effects have garnered a niche following, with collectors appreciating its distinctive take on the absurdities of fame and identity. Copies in good condition can be quite sought after, especially for those who enjoy films that challenge conventional narratives.
